Citymind (legally Citymind solutions s.r.o.) is a Czech technology startup based in Brno, Czech Republic.[1] [2] It was founded as a spin-off from Mendel University in Brno and Masaryk University, and Mendel University in Brno continues to support the startup to this day.[3] Citymind specialises in artificial intelligence agents and chatbots for municipalities, universities and private companies. [4] The company is known for being the first to use AI to create a chatbot for a city in the Czech Republic. [5][6]


History

Citymind was founded in Brno and started as an local academic startup ecosystem at Mendel University in Brno and Masaryk University with support from the South Moravian Innovation Centre.[7][8] The project got attention early on by winning the MENDELU Boost competition. They won with their AI assistant for municipalities and universities.[9]

Projects

In May 2024, Citymind launched a pilot project in the municipality of Mokrá-Horákov.[10][11][12] According to Český rozhlas (Czech Radio), this was the first instance of a generative AI chatbot being used by a local government in the Czech Republic to communicate with citizens. The system was designed to answer questions regarding waste management, local fees, and administrative procedures.[13]

The next and largest project is the deployment of the technology in the Prague 6 municipality in 2025. This implementation was part of the European Union-funded CommuniCity project, which aims to test digital solutions to social challenges in urban environments.[14]

Citymind was also mentioned in the Social Impact Award Czechia competition, in 2023 [15] The company was also featured in Czech and Slovak media, such as Hospodářské noviny[11], Czech Television[16] and Czech Radio[10].
